Q: Did you visit New Orleans or know that the Saints were interested
in you?
A: Yes I did, about two weeks ago they flew me there for a visit.
Last week on Wednesday, Coach Orgeron and I had a nice workout.
Q: Did you do anything with Sedrick Ellis in any all star game
or have you come across him very much in the offseason?
A: Sed (Sedrick Ellis) and I kind of built a little relationship
at the Senior Bowl because he and I were both on the north side.
He and I have actually played against each other so this is probably
going to turn out for the good.
Q: Do you think your injuries this past season prevented you
from being a higher draft choice?
A: Yes. Whenever I talked with a scout or a coach they always
brought up my injuries and asked me if I was healthy. They would
ask me how my knee is or how is my wrist. They would also ask
me if I am prone to injuries. I think it did hurt me a lot me
because I was hurt through two and a half games.
Q: What is your answer to the injury questions?
A: Those two injuries were the only major ones that I have had
in my four years there (in college). I think that they were both
just a freak accident. I am a tough guy and I can handle it.
Q: Do you play both tackle positions and what do you envision
yourself playing more comfortably in the NFL?
A: I play both tackle positions. Coach O (Orgeron) said that
he would probably see me at the three technique and I don’t
really care where I play, but I can play both.
Q: How do you feel about your pass rush abilities?
A: Personally, I have been trying to work on it a lot. I have
been trying to get stronger in that area. I like to think of my
pass rush as a ‘will be’. Right now, I would say I
am a good pass rusher.
Q: People haven’t seen on a consistent basis what you are
capable of, are you looking to show that this season?
A: My senior year, because I was a little hurt half of the year
I was rebounding off of my knee injury, but I think the last six
games I was able to show more of what I can do. I am going to
work hard this offseason and preseason to really show everybody
what I can do.
Q: When the Saints moved up their pick today, were you surprised
they picked you since they had already chosen DT Sedrick Ellis?
A: I was kind of surprised, but Coach (Orgeron) said that I had
a really good workout so I wasn’t totally surprised. He
said that he was really impressed and that he believes in me.
